A Little Bit About Us...
Kariatethes, a literary society, was founded in 1957. It was officially recognized in 1959 by the Wisconsin State University at Platteville. In 1965, Kariatheses became Kappa Alpha sigma. Since then, the Kappa Alpha Sigma sorority has promoted their seven virtues: love, hope, charity, honesty, loyalty, obedience and self help. We try to better our campus in every way we can.
The flower is the pink tea rose.
The jewel is the ruby.
The Kappa Alpha Sigma brother fraternity was Lambda Sigma Pi.
The current Kappa Alpha Sigma House is located at 520 W. Main St, Platteville, WI.
Our motto is "Loyalty Always, Sisterhood Forever."
